Boosted Operational Effectiveness

The presence of foam can impede manufacturing by obstructing tools, lowering capacity, and complicating procedure control. By minimizing surface tension, they help with the rapid collapse of foam, allowing for smoother procedure and decreasing downtime.

In sectors such as food and beverage, drugs, and wastewater treatment, the application of defoamers improves procedure stability and product top quality. For instance, in fermentation processes, regulating foam generation is crucial for making best use of yield and efficiency. Furthermore, the use of defoamers can cause extra effective blending and oygenation, causing boosted response times and overall productivity.

Additionally, when foam is successfully controlled, it lowers the threat of overflow and contamination, making sure conformity with safety and security and high quality requirements. Eventually, the combination of chemical defoamers into commercial processes promotes a much more reliable process, maximizing outcome while preserving top notch requirements.

Improved Product Top Quality


Using chemical defoamers plays a critical duty in enhancing product quality across various markets. Too much foam can lead to irregular item formulas, impacting the final characteristics of goods such as paints, finishes, food, and pharmaceuticals. By reducing foam development, chemical defoamers assist in smoother manufacturing procedures, making certain that formulas stay consistent and fulfill specific high quality standards.

In the food and beverage sector, as an example, the presence of foam can impact the clearness and taste of products, eventually affecting customer fulfillment. Chemical defoamers assist keep the preferred appearance and look, thus improving the overall top quality of the end product. In the manufacturing of layers and paints, foam can lead to defects such as pinholes and poor attachment, threatening the item's performance.

Additionally, the usage of defoamers can enhance the efficiency of procedures like fermentation and emulsification, which are important for accomplishing desired item features. Devices Security and Long Life

Decreasing foam manufacturing is crucial for protecting equipment and ensuring its longevity in different industrial applications. Excessive foam can lead to an array of functional concerns, including equipment damage, enhanced maintenance expenses, and unplanned downtime. When foam builds up, it can cause overflow, bring about spills that jeopardize the integrity of machinery and surrounding areas.

Moreover, foam can block pumps and sensing units, which can prevent efficiency and efficiency. In serious cases, it can result in the break down of elements, demanding expensive repair services or replacements. Adaptability Throughout Industries

Chemical defoamers play a crucial role in different markets, efficiently dealing with foam-related difficulties across diverse applications. Their versatility appears in sectors such as food and beverage, pharmaceuticals, and wastewater treatment, where foam can minimize and restrain processes efficiency. In the food market, defoamers guarantee smooth manufacturing by stopping foam formation during blending, fermentation, and bottling, thus maintaining item top quality and uniformity.

Chemical DefoamerChemical Defoamer
In pharmaceutical production, defoamers are crucial for improving the performance of solutions by reducing foam that can hinder giving and mixing. This is especially essential in the manufacturing of syrups and emulsions, where the existence of foam can impact dose accuracy and product stability.

In addition, in wastewater therapy facilities, chemical defoamers are used to control foam during the aeration process, promoting optimum microbial task and boosting the general therapy effectiveness.
